Looking for something to do on the Outer Banks this upcoming Memorial Day weekend? On Sunday, May 29th from 6 to 10 p.m. check out the Marsh Grass Music Festival and hear the sweet sounds of blues on the lawns of Currituck Heritage Park and the Whalehead Club.

For more than 30 years, Kitty Hawk Kites has hosted one of the biggest flying spectaculars short of the Wright brothers’ first flight. It is back again as Kitty Hawk Kites Hang Gliding Spectacular and Air Games is set for May 20-23 at Jockey’s Ridge State Park in Nags Head.
